Shed Size
Let’s start with size. First, think about everything you currently own that will be stored in the shed and try to anticipate what you might add in the future. Be honest with yourself! You don’t want to overspend on a large storage shed that you’ll never fill. Conversely, if you purchase a small shed without considering your future storage needs, you may run out of space in the coming years. We recommend selecting a shed one to two sizes larger than you need today. This not only gives you extra room to stay organized—it also provides much needed space to reorganize between seasons.
Shed Material
A shed needs to be functional first and foremost—but most folks are looking for something stylish as well. Select a shed constructed from material that is low maintenance, durable, weather resistant, and attractive. Resin is a great solution because it satisfies all of the above while keeping costs in check!

Shed Fabrication
While it would be nice to snap your fingers and have a shed appear in your yard, the reality is you’re going to have to assemble it first. Look for a shed that’s easy to transport and requires minimal tools. With a little help from a friend, you’ll have your shed up in as little as a few hours!
